Avalanche Activity

TO for 08.01. Windslab instabilities forming and gaining depth on NW to NE aspects above 900m. Cornices! Moderate Hazard.

Forecast Snow Stability: The old snowpack will remain generally well bonded and stable on most aspects. By the early hours accumulations of windslab will begin to develop, and where they gain depth at higher elevations, localised instabilities will begin to affect wind sheltered steep terrain on North-West to North-East aspects above 900 meters. The tops of gullies and scarp slopes being particularity affected. Unstable cornices will develop. Southerly aspects will become scoured. The avalanche hazard will be Moderate.

Snowpack Structure

Forecast Weather Influences: Gale force South-South-East winds will veer to the South then South-South-Westerly, remaining gale force overnight then reduce in strength, becoming strong. There will be scattered showers overnight, wintry at higher levels falling as heavy sleet and snow. The freezing level will hover around 700-900 meters throughout the period. Observed Weather Influences: It has been a dry day with some brighter periods. Winds have been strong Southerly. The freezing level was around 800 metres. ObservedSnowStability: The snow has depleted overnight becoming more patchy with some firming at higher levels where the snow has refrozen in the cooler temperatures. The snowpack is generally well consolidated and stable at all elevations and aspects. The avalanche hazard is Low.
